What legal considerations should be taken into account when creating a traveling power of attorney?

When creating a traveling power of attorney, it is important to consider the legal requirements and regulations of the specific jurisdictions where the document may be used. This includes ensuring that the power of attorney is valid and recognized in all relevant locations, understanding any differences in laws between states or countries, and complying with any specific requirements for the document to be legally binding while traveling. Additionally, it is important to choose a trustworthy and reliable agent to act on your behalf and to clearly outline the scope of their authority in the power of attorney document.

What is a draft deed?

A draft deed is a preliminary version of a legal document that outlines the terms and conditions of a property transfer or other legal agreement. It serves as a template for the final deed, allowing parties to review, negotiate, and make necessary amendments before formal execution. Draft deeds typically include key details such as the identities of the parties involved, the property description, and any specific provisions related to the transaction. Once finalized and executed, the draft deed becomes a legally binding document.

Can a regular notary notarize a legal document in NC?

Yes, a regular notary public in North Carolina can notarize legal documents, provided they are authorized to perform notarial acts. The notary must ensure that the signer is present, verifies their identity, and confirms their willingness to sign the document. However, the notary cannot provide legal advice or draft legal documents unless they are also a licensed attorney.


What are the key considerations to keep in mind when drafting a prenup document?

When drafting a prenup document, it is important to consider full financial disclosure, fairness and equity in the agreement, independent legal advice for both parties, clarity in language and terms, and the potential for future changes in circumstances.
